> import dummy_class
> d=dummy_class()

But you have a problem with namespaces.

the class 'dummy_class' is inside the module 'dummy_class'
So when you import the module that allows you to use the 
name 'dummy_class' to refer to the *contents* of that module.

To access the class 'dummy_class' you need to prepend it 
with the name of the module:

d = dummy_class.dummy_class()
